L’esempio di codice seguente mostra come utilizzare AssignOpportunity.
- SDK per Python (Boto3)
-
Riassegna un’opportunità esistente a un altro utente.
#!/usr/bin/env python """ Purpose PC-API-07 Assigning a new owner """ import logging import boto3 import utils.helpers as helper from botocore.client import ClientError from utils.constants import CATALOG_TO_USE serviceName = "partnercentral-selling" partner_central_client = boto3.client( service_name=serviceName, region_name='us-east-1' ) def assign_opportunity(identifier): assign_opportunity_request ={ "Catalog": CATALOG_TO_USE, "Identifier": identifier, "Assignee": { "BusinessTitle": "OpportunityOwner", "Email": "test@test.com", "FirstName": "John", "LastName": "Doe" } } try: # Perform an API call response = partner_central_client.assign_opportunity(**assign_opportunity_request) return response except ClientError as err: # Catch all client exceptions print(err.response) def usage_demo(): identifier = "O4236468" logging.basicConfig(level=logging.INFO, format="%(levelname)s: %(message)s") print("-" * 88) print("Assigning a new owner to an opportunity.") print("-" * 88) helper.pretty_print_datetime(assign_opportunity(identifier)) if __name__ == "__main__": usage_demo()-

L’esempio di codice seguente mostra come utilizzare AssociateOpportunity.
- SDK per Python (Boto3)
-
Crea un’associazione formale tra un’opportunità e varie entità correlate.
#!/usr/bin/env python """ Purpose PC-API -11 Associating a product PC-API -12 Associating a solution PC-API -13 Associating an offer """ import logging import boto3 import utils.helpers as helper from botocore.client import ClientError from utils.constants import CATALOG_TO_USE serviceName = "partnercentral-selling" partner_central_client = boto3.client( service_name=serviceName, region_name='us-east-1' ) def associate_opportunity(entity_type, entity_identifier, opportunityIdentifier): associate_opportunity_request ={ "Catalog": CATALOG_TO_USE, "OpportunityIdentifier" : opportunityIdentifier, "RelatedEntityType" : entity_type, "RelatedEntityIdentifier" : entity_identifier } try: # Perform an API call response = partner_central_client.associate_opportunity(**associate_opportunity_request) return response except ClientError as err: # Catch all client exceptions print(err.response) def usage_demo(): #entity_type = Solutions | AWSProducts | AWSMarketplaceOffers entity_type = "Solutions" entity_identifier = "S-0059717" opportunityIdentifier = "O5465588" logging.basicConfig(level=logging.INFO, format="%(levelname)s: %(message)s") print("-" * 88) print("Associate Opportunity.") print("-" * 88) helper.pretty_print_datetime(associate_opportunity(entity_type, entity_identifier, opportunityIdentifier)) if __name__ == "__main__": usage_demo()-

L’esempio di codice seguente mostra come utilizzare ListOpportunities.
- SDK per Python (Boto3)
-
Elenca le opportunità.
#!/usr/bin/env python """ Purpose PC-API -18 Getting list of Opportunities """ import json import logging import boto3 import utils.helpers as helper from utils.constants import CATALOG_TO_USE serviceName = "partnercentral-selling" partner_central_client = boto3.client( service_name=serviceName, region_name='us-east-1' ) def get_list_of_opportunities(): opportunity_list = [] list_opportunities_request ={ "Catalog": CATALOG_TO_USE, "MaxResults": 20 } try: # Perform an API call response = partner_central_client.list_opportunities(**list_opportunities_request) opportunity_list.extend(response["OpportunitySummaries"]) while "NextToken" in response and response["NextToken"] is not None: list_opportunities_request["NextToken"] = response["NextToken"] response = partner_central_client.list_opportunities(**list_opportunities_request) opportunity_list.extend(response["OpportunitySummaries"]) return opportunity_list except Exception as err: # Catch all client exceptions print(json.dumps(err.response)) def usage_demo(): logging.basicConfig(level=logging.INFO, format="%(levelname)s: %(message)s") print("-" * 88) print("Getting list of Opportunities.") print("-" * 88) helper.pretty_print_datetime(get_list_of_opportunities()) if __name__ == "__main__": usage_demo()-

L’esempio di codice seguente mostra come utilizzare RejectEngagementInvitation.
- SDK per Python (Boto3)
-
Per rifiutare un invito di coinvolgimento condiviso da AWS.
#!/usr/bin/env python """ Purpose PC-API-05 AWS Originated AO rejection - RejectOpportunityEngagementInvitation - Rejects a engagement invitation. This action indicates that the partner does not wish to participate in the engagement and provides a reason for the rejection. Upon rejection, a OpportunityEngagementInvitationRejected event is triggered. Subsequently, the invitation will no longer be available for the partner to act on. """ import json import logging import boto3 import utils.helpers as helper from utils.constants import CATALOG_TO_USE serviceName = "partnercentral-selling" partner_central_client = boto3.client( service_name=serviceName, region_name='us-east-1' ) def reject_opportunity_engagement_invitation(identifier, reject_reason): reject_opportunity_engagement_invitation_request ={ "Catalog": CATALOG_TO_USE, "Identifier": identifier, "RejectionReason": reject_reason } try: # Perform an API call response = partner_central_client.reject_engagement_invitation(**reject_opportunity_engagement_invitation_request) return response except Exception as err: # Catch all client exceptions print(json.dumps(err.response)) def usage_demo(): identifier = "arn:aws:partnercentral:us-east-1::catalog/Sandbox/engagement-invitation/engi-0000002isviga" reject_reason = "Customer problem unclear" logging.basicConfig(level=logging.INFO, format="%(levelname)s: %(message)s") print("-" * 88) print("Given the ARN identifier and reject reason, reject the Opportunity Engagement Invitation.") print("-" * 88) helper.pretty_print_datetime(reject_opportunity_engagement_invitation(identifier, reject_reason)) if __name__ == "__main__": usage_demo()-

L’esempio di codice seguente mostra come utilizzare StartEngagementByAcceptingInvitationTask.
- SDK per Python (Boto3)
-
Avvia il coinvolgimento accettando un invito di coinvolgimento.
#!/usr/bin/env python """ Purpose PC-API -11 Associating a product PC-API -12 Associating a solution PC-API -13 Associating an offer """ import logging import boto3 import utils.helpers as helper from botocore.client import ClientError from utils.constants import CATALOG_TO_USE serviceName = "partnercentral-selling" partner_central_client = boto3.client( service_name=serviceName, region_name='us-east-1' ) def get_opportunity(identifier): get_opportunity_request ={ "Identifier": identifier, "Catalog": CATALOG_TO_USE } try: # Perform an API call response = partner_central_client.get_engagement_invitation(**get_opportunity_request) return response except ClientError as err: # Catch all client exceptions print(err.response) def start_engagement_by_accepting_invitation_task(identifier): response = get_opportunity(identifier) if ( response['Status'] == 'PENDING') : accept_opportunity_engagement_invitation_request ={ "Catalog": CATALOG_TO_USE, "Identifier" : identifier, "ClientToken": "test-123456" } try: # Perform an API call response = partner_central_client.start_engagement_by_accepting_invitation_task(**accept_opportunity_engagement_invitation_request) return response except ClientError as err: # Catch all client exceptions print(err.response) return None else: return None def usage_demo(): identifier = "arn:aws:partnercentral:us-east-1::catalog/Sandbox/engagement-invitation/engi-0000002isusga" logging.basicConfig(level=logging.INFO, format="%(levelname)s: %(message)s") print("-" * 88) print("Get updated Opportunity.") print("-" * 88) helper.pretty_print_datetime(start_engagement_by_accepting_invitation_task(identifier)) if __name__ == "__main__": usage_demo()-

Scenari
L’esempio di codice seguente mostra come:
Annullare l’associazione di una vecchia entità.
Associare una nuova entità.
- SDK per Python (Boto3)
-
Nota
Ulteriori informazioni su GitHub. Trova l’esempio completo e scopri di più sulla configurazione e l’esecuzione nel Repository di esempi di codice AWS
. Aggiornare l’entità associata di un’opportunità
#!/usr/bin/env python """ Purpose PC-API -17 Replacing a solution """ import logging import boto3 import utils.helpers as helper from botocore.client import ClientError from utils.constants import CATALOG_TO_USE serviceName = "partnercentral-selling" partner_central_client = boto3.client( service_name=serviceName, region_name='us-east-1' ) def replace_solution(original_entity_identifier, new_entity_identifier, opportunityIdentifier): disassociate_opportunity_request ={ "Catalog": CATALOG_TO_USE, "OpportunityIdentifier" : opportunityIdentifier, "RelatedEntityType" : "Solutions", "RelatedEntityIdentifier" : original_entity_identifier } associate_opportunity_request ={ "Catalog": CATALOG_TO_USE, "OpportunityIdentifier" : opportunityIdentifier, "RelatedEntityType" : "Solutions", "RelatedEntityIdentifier" : new_entity_identifier } try: # Perform an API call response = partner_central_client.disassociate_opportunity(**disassociate_opportunity_request) response = partner_central_client.associate_opportunity(**associate_opportunity_request) return response except ClientError as err: # Catch all client exceptions print(err.response) def usage_demo(): original_entity_identifier = "S-0049999" new_entity_identifier = "S-0050014" opportunityIdentifier = "O4397574" logging.basicConfig(level=logging.INFO, format="%(levelname)s: %(message)s") print("-" * 88) print("Replacing a solution.") print("-" * 88) helper.pretty_print_datetime(replace_solution(original_entity_identifier, new_entity_identifier, opportunityIdentifier)) if __name__ == "__main__": usage_demo()-
